H12 UOL is a 2001 Mitsubishi 3000 in Black with a 2,972c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 77.8%.

Across all 2001 Mitsubishi 3000 models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.5% with a typical mileage of 97,775 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Mitsubishi 3000 f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 1,151 recorded failures. If you're considering buying H12 UOL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Mitsubishi 3000 typ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 25 years old, this Mitsubishi 3000 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
